Program Analyst IVBryceTech is a trusted leader in complex technology domains, delivering data-driven solutions in aerospace, biosecurity, and defense. We specialize in systems engineering, advanced analytics, R&D programs, and strategic advisory support. Our clients – including NASA, DoD, HHS, DHS, and other civil and national security agencies – rely on us to drive mission success and accelerate innovation.BryceTech is seeking a Program Analyst IV to support the Capability Program Executive for Chemical, Biological, Radiological and Nuclear Defense (CPE CBRND), Joint Project Manager for CBRN Integrated Early Warning (JPM CBRN IEW).The Program Analyst IV will provide senior-level program analysis, data analysis, planning, reporting, and decision-support support to government leadership and program teams. This position will analyze program information and performance data, develop reports and visualizations, monitor schedules and milestones, identify trends and risks, and translate complex information into clear recommendations for senior stakeholders.The ideal candidate is a highly analytical and organized professional who can work independently, manage multiple priorities, and communicate effectively with both technical and senior government personnel.
